Subject: Replacement server for Marlow Street branch

Hi dispatch — the replacement Fennwick rack server for the Marlow Street branch ships out tomorrow with Coppervale Couriers. It's one crate, heavy, needs the trolley. Branch IT will meet the driver at the rear entrance around 11:00. Heads up for the branch: the driver will only hand it over against the phrase below.

handover note for yagef-bagep: the drudor pelius courier leaves the kasdor zorvan norir ledger at gate 8016 under passcode 755406

Need to get someone into the hardware lab at Quillstone Works? Easy enough, but a few rules apply: lab access is ground floor only, safety glasses go on before the inner door, and no food past the airlock. Visitors must be badged in by a lab member at all times. For facilities staff doing after-hours checks, the lab door takes the pass code below.

turnstile pass: bdg-TXR-4

Break-Glass: Proselint-9 Documentation Linter

Quick note for the sync: Proselint-9 gates every docs merge, and occasionally its rule service falls over and blocks the whole queue. Break-glass lets one on-call person bypass the gate for up to an hour — please post in the channel first so we know it happened. The bypass console runs under a sealed admin account, and unlocking it requires the passphrase kept right below.

unlock words, hahip-yagef: zorok-novmir-zorix-silax

Leadership Review Briefing — Sales Leads, Quarro Systems

Marketing spend cut 22% effective next month. Trade shows paused; digital spend halved; the Vexlin launch campaign survives intact. Expect thinner lead flow in the Dorren territory through Q3. Comp plans unchanged. Pipeline targets hold. Direct questions to Priya Stannard. Rationale and downstream plans are captured in the confidential note below.

board note of bawep-tajef: Queniusek Systems plans to raise the Quenvan list price by 53.1 percent in March. The pricing group signed off on a budget of $176.4 million for Project Drueth. The renewal with Casionix Partners closes at $142.5 million a year, 8.3 percent below the last contract. Project Fraax slips by six weeks because of the tooling delay.